The Inflation Reduction Act of 2022 will have its impact on your patients and clients as early as next year. Medicare has begun to negotiate drug prices for the first time since 2011. The CMS announcement "Medicare Drug Prices Soon to Fall," below, explains that it will take effect gradually by adding more drugs to the negotiation table every year.
